Abstract

The effect of preliminary radiation-oxidative treatment on the current density and current–voltage characteristic of metallic zirconium has been studied. The contribution of preliminary radiation-oxidative treatment to the change in the electrophysical characteristics during thermal and radiation–thermal tests in the contact of zirconium with water is revealed.
